Whether you are an experienced practitioner or early in your career, you're about to embark on a journey that truly counts in a region known for its warmth and diversity. Job Description
- Create Tailored Treatment Plans: Assess individual patient needs and design personalized therapy strategies to help them reach their functional objectives
- Implement Therapeutic Interventions: Apply evidence-based techniques to improve motor skills, cognitive functions, and everyday living activities for your patients
- Collaborate with Multidisciplinary Teams: Work alongside other OTs, PTs, STs, physicians, and nurses to ensure comprehensive, patient-centric care
- Guide Patients and Caregivers: Provide education to patients and their families about therapeutic techniques to promote ongoing success at home
- Assess Progress and Document Outcomes: Monitor patient development and modify treatment plans as needed to keep them on track for recovery
- Degree in Occupational Therapy from an accredited institution
- Encouragement and support for ongoing education and specialty certifications
- Valid Occupational Therapist (OTR/L) license required
- NBCOT (National Board for Certification in Occupational Therapy) certification essential
